Housing resources in Warren
Local HUD-funded Continuum of Care coordinated-entry intake for Warren-area veterans experiencing homelessness. CoCs route veterans to HUD-VASH, SSVF, GPD transitional housing, and local nonprofit partners.
Free civil legal help for Warren-area veterans from Lakeshore Legal Aid (Macomb County), the legal-aid organization serving Warren, MI. Common matters include discharge upgrades, VA benefits appeals, family law, housing, and consumer issues.
SSVF grantee outreach for very low-income veteran families in Warren who are homeless or at imminent risk of homelessness. SSVF can fund rapid re-housing, temporary financial assistance, and case management.
HUD-VASH (Housing & Urban Development - VA Supportive Housing) combines a Housing Choice Voucher with VA case management for homeless Warren veterans. Apply through the local public housing authority and your nearest VA medical center.
Public Housing Authorities (PHAs) serving Warren, MI administer the Housing Choice Voucher used for HUD-VASH. Use HUD's official PHA contact list to find the right local PHA, request the veteran-priority waitlist, and confirm intake hours.

Frequently Asked Questions
- Where can a veteran get housing help in Warren?
- Start with the resources listed on this page, which are filtered to Warren and the surrounding Michigan area. If you do not see what you need, expand to the full Michigan housing guide or call the National Call Center for Homeless Veterans at 1-877-424-3838 for an immediate referral.
- What is the closest VA facility to Warren?
- Veterans in Warren are typically served by the nearest VA facility serving Warren. Call 1-877-222-8387 or visit VA.gov/find-locations to confirm the right campus, clinic hours, and what services are offered before you travel.
- Are these Warren housing resources free for veterans?
- Most listed resources are free or low-cost for eligible veterans. Eligibility, copays, and waitlists vary by program, so confirm cost and required documents (DD-214, VA award letter, proof of residency) when you call.
- Who do I call first if I am a homeless veteran in Warren?
- Dial the National Call Center for Homeless Veterans at 1-877-424-3838 (24/7). Ask for the SSVF grantee and HUD-VASH coordinator nearest Warren; they can begin a rapid-rehousing intake the same day in most cases.
